Angel Court Trunk Show at Masons on Joyce!

Angel Court jewelry has long been a favorite here at Masons. The company was started by Angela Burgess and Courtney Taylor who take vintage jewels and rework them into their own jewelry masterpieces. Both Angela and Courtney are from the South so it makes sense that each Angel Court piece is handcrafted in Meridian Mississippi as well as a public relations office in Little Rock, Arkansas.

The designers work together trying to find modern elements to mix with vintage to create what they call “romantic sensibility yet rock n roll edge.”
